Though West Kirby station lacks a dedicated ticket office, it is equipped with ticket machines where you can easily purchase or collect your pre-booked tickets. For those embracing the digital age, smartcards are both issued and validated at the station.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access provided throughout, ensuring a comfortable experience for all passengers. You can rely on the help point for assistance, as well as customer help points that are available at the station.
Despite the station's conveniences, it currently does not offer luggage storage, waiting rooms, or accessible toilets. Yet, for an optimally balanced pitstop, visitors can enjoy a hot drink from the café or grab a quick snack from vending machines. Though there's no public Wi-Fi, it's a great excuse to "switch off" and admire the seaside charm of West Kirby.
Although West Kirby train station doesn't offer a taxi service directly at its doorstep, onward travel is readily facilitated via buses. The local bus services can be checked on the official Merseytravel website, or by contacting Traveline for comprehensive travel advice. Moreover, connections to Liverpool John Lennon Airport are convenient as you can purchase a combined rail and bus ticket to travel seamlessly to the airport from any Merseyrail station.

At Blake Street, you'll find a convenient ticket office with various opening times throughout the week. Monday sees the earliest start at 6 AM, winding down by 4 PM, while the rest of the week offers a mix of shorter hours. For added convenience, ticket machines are available, including options to collect tickets you purchased online. While Blake Street lacks some modern amenities like public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ities, rest assured that essential features like CCTV and staff assistance during opening hours bolster the station's safety and security. It should be noted that step-free access is available, although limited to certain parts of the station.
Traveling beyond the station is straightforward with several transport links available. Rail replacement services are organized from the car park entrance on Shelley Drive when needed, while local cab services such as Sutton Radio and Parkers offer taxi options. The public bus network is an accessory to your journey as well, with printable information available online to help plan your onward trip.
